Responsibilities
- Design, build, and maintain the end-to-end real-time video pipeline: WebRTC/RTSP/RTMP ingest, hardware-accelerated transcoding, and simultaneous multi-stream rendering for up to 10 concurrent robot video feeds.
- Architect and optimize GStreamer-based multi-branch pipelines for video capture, processing, recording, and cloud upload (S3) - including codec selection, pad/cap negotiation, and plugin development.
- Own the full audio subsystem: real-time two-way audio, SIP/VoIP integration (pjsip/Asterisk), text-to-speech (AWS Polly), and talk-down functionality with a sub-200ms end-to-end round-trip latency target.
- Implement and optimize WebRTC signaling, ICE, DTLS-SRTP, and media server components for reliable low-latency communication across distributed robot deployments.
- Build Make-a-Clip functionality enabling operators to extract, annotate, and store video segments from live and recorded feeds.
- Define and maintain A/V API contracts in collaboration with ICM and Signals platform engineers; contribute to code reviews, technical documentation, and on-call runbooks.
